Snapdragon 6 Gen 4 vs Dimensity 7400: Benchmark score, spec sheet, and more
Qualcomm's Snapdragon 6 Gen 4 and MediaTek's Dimensity 7400 are emerging as key competitors in the lower-mid-range smartphone chip market. Both processors aim to deliver advanced capabilities and high performance, making modern smartphone features accessible at more affordable price points. The Snapdragon 6 Gen 4 emphasizes high-end architectural elements, including Cortex-A720 cores and premium gaming functionalities, adapted for cost-effective devices. Conversely, the Dimensity 7400 is designed with a primary focus on maximizing raw performance. This head-to-head comparison evaluates their benchmark scores, specifications, and overall value proposition for manufacturers and consumers in the budget-conscious segment.
